From the bestselling author Robert Greene comes a brilliant distillation of the strategies of war that can help us gain mastery in the modern world. Through an intricate examination of historical events, famous figures, and classic works of literature, The 33 Strategies of War offers readers a detailed roadmap to navigate the subtle social battles of everyday life. Spanning world civilisations and synthesising dozens of political, philosophical, and religious texts, The 33 Strategies of War is a comprehensive guide that draws on timeless wisdom and strategic thinking. Greene delves into the minds of some of history's most brilliant and notorious leaders to reveal the strategies that brought them success and failure. Packed with meticulously researched examples, from the cunning exploits of Napoleon and the decisive tactics of Margaret Thatcher to the resilient manoeuvres of Hannibal and the unwavering leadership of Ulysses S. Grant, Greene transforms lessons from the battlefield into clear, actionable insights. These are further enriched by the strategies employed by diplomats, captains of industry, and Samurai swordsmen. About the Author

Robert Greene, author of The 48 Laws of Power and The Art of Seduction (both from Profile), has a degree in Classical Studies and has been an editor at Esquire and other magazines. He is also a playwright and lives in Los Angeles. Click here for his website.
